Thomas Pieters snaps a golf club around his neck
Belgium’s Thomas Pieters wasn’t exactly happy with one of his approach shots during Friday’s second round of the BMW PGA Championship.
After missing the green by a long way, Pieters let his frustrations out by snapping the golf club on the back of his neck.
